Kathmandu

Trailer for the upcoming sports drama Damaru ko Dandibiyo, which features actors Khagendra Lamichhane and Anup Baral, has hit the airwaves. 

The film tells the story of Damaru (Khagendra Lamichhane) who returns to his village with an aim to revive the game of Dandi Biyo. “But his father, who was once a good player, opposes his move and wants him to concentrate on his career instead. Damaru then is left with no option but to defeat his father in a Dandi Biyo match if he wants to pursue his dream,” the film’s logline reads. 

Written by Lamichhane, Damaru ko Dandibiyo is directed by Chhetan Gurung, in what will be his debut directorial. Prior to this, director Gurung was involved as a writer for films such as November Rain and Diary.  Speaking at the film’s announcement event, director Gurung said, “I have taken the film as a good project to use my experiences in the industry and to broaden my horizon. I am excited.”

The producers have said that the film will border around the social and sports drama genre, possibly for the first time in the recent Kollywood history. The film, shot around Lamjung, Manang, and Kathmandu, will release on May 4. Alongside Lamichhane and Baral, the film features actors Menuka Pradhan, Ankit Khadka, Aashant Sharma, Buddhi Tamang, Laxmi Bardewa, Mihri Thapa, and Namita Ghising, among others.
